二维数组求指定元素的占用地址

[复制链接]
查看11 | 回复3 | 2013-6-2 14:15:14 | 显示全部楼层 |阅读模式
数组元素地址的计算是有固定公式的,以列为主序存储的计算公式为:起始地址+((列号-1)*行数+列位置数-1)*每个元素的字节数。=1000+(4*6+5-1)*5=1000+140=1140...
回复

使用道具 举报

千问 | 2013-6-2 14:15:14 | 显示全部楼层
注意题目条件是以列为主序存储,不是通常的以行为主序A[5][5]=1000+(6*5+5)*5=1175...
回复

使用道具 举报

千问 | 2013-6-2 14:15:14 | 显示全部楼层
A[6][7] 相当于(A[7])[6];A[5][5] = 1000 +5 * 7 * 5 + 5 * 5 = 1200...
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

主题

0

回帖

4882万

积分

论坛元老

Rank: 8Rank: 8

积分
48824836
热门排行